Author, Speaker, YouTuber, Small Steps Coach Sid Garza-Hillman doles out his perspective on everything from health & wellness, politics, news, nutrition, fitness and more. Want to hear what Sid thinks? This is the place. Find out more at http://sidgarzahillman.com. P.S. You might remember him from the Approaching the Natural Podcast. Same guy, new show.
